Resultados da pesquisa a pedido "has-many-through"

12 a resposta

Rails - Classifica por dados da tabela de junção

Eu tenho um projeto de RoR em andamento. Aqui estão as seções aplicáveis dos meus modelos. Cas has_many :communities, :through => :availabilities has_many :availabilities, :order => "price ASC"Comunidad has_many :homes, :through => ...

4 a resposta

Rails / ActiveRecord has_many through: associação em objetos não salvos

Vamos trabalhar com estas classes: class User < ActiveRecord::Base has_many :project_participations has_many :projects, through: :project_participations, inverse_of: :users end class ProjectParticipation < ActiveRecord::Base belongs_to :user ...

1 a resposta

has_many: através de perguntas

5 a resposta

Como implementar um modelo de amizade no Rails 3 para um aplicativo de rede social?

Atualmente, estou trabalhando em um pequeno aplicativo de rede social e agora estou tentando criar um modelo que represente amizades entreComercia. Isto é o que eu vim até agora: class User < ActiveRecord::Base # ... has_many :friendships ...

4 a resposta

Selecionando elegantemente atributos de has_many: através de modelos de junção no Rails

Gostaria de saber qual é a maneira mais fácil / elegante de selecionar atributos de modelos de junção no has_many: através de associações. Vamos dizer que temos Items, Catalogs e CatalogItems com a seguinte classe Item: class Item < ...

1 a resposta

Rails 4: counter_cache em has_many: através da associação com dependente:: destroy

Embora perguntas semelhantes já tenham sido feitas: counter_cache com has_many: através [https://stackoverflow.com/questions/5256897/counter-cache-with-has-many-through] dependente => destruir em uma associação "has_many ...

1 a resposta

has_many: através de constante não inicializada

Eu li as documentações e toneladas de tutoriais sobre o has_many: através de relações no Rails, mas eu não posso para a vida de mim pegar o jeito dele.Estou ...

1 a resposta

has_many: através de uma chave estrangeira?

Li várias perguntas sobre isso, mas ainda não encontrei uma resposta que funcione para minha situação.Eu tenho 3 modelos:

4 a resposta

Rails: Por que a associação “has_many…,: through =>…” resulta em “NameError: constante não inicializada…”

Para expressar que um grupo pode ter vários usuários e um usuário pode pertencer a vários grupos, defino as seguintes associações: class Group < ActiveRecord::Base has_many :users_groups has_many :users, :through => :users_groups end class User ...

2 a resposta

HMT collection_singular_ids = a exclusão de modelos de junção é direta, nenhum retorno de chamada de destruição é acionado

Acabei de encontrar um problema com um has_many: a associação e os retornos de chamada após / antes da destruição não foram acionados. Digamos, eu tenho usuários, grupos e uma relação intermediária chamada associação. Eu tenho um formulário que ...